Microsoft Dynamics GP is a staple in the accounting and ERP space. Great Plains has been around since 1981 and was acquired by Microsoft in the year 2000. After the acquisition, the software boomed and businesses now have years upon years of data stored on their GP servers. Intelligent Cloud

Development of the intelligent cloud has been somewhat of a revolution for Microsoft. The intelligent cloud can do many things, but most important to accountants is what it does with your GP data. You can now upload all that data to the cloud to pull reports and create dashboards by harnessing the power Dynamics 365 Business Central, the latest in Microsoft accounting software.

The release of Dynamics GP 2018 R2 added “Intelligent Edge” functionality which is essential for communication with the Intelligent Cloud. This feature creates a bridge for on-premises systems like GP, SL, and NAV to communicate with the cloud and move data to programs like Power BI, Flow, and Dynamics Business Central. Now, this won’t allow you to move data back to GP, but it’s a start.

Your Data, Unlocked

The documentation from Microsoft clearly states “When the connection is made, we securely replicate your on-premises data to the intelligent cloud. You simply decide which companies you want to replicate (all if you choose), and then, within the main pages of your on-premises solution, we’ll deliver back actionable analysis and content.”.
